Material:

Polypropylene PlasticPolypropylene (PP) is a tough plastic that has excellent chemical resistance. PP is translucent in its natural state but can have a glossy finish when produced with color. Some examples of common products made with PP are dairy and medication containers. Polypropylene is suitable for hot fill applications of up to 205°F and is therefore great for autoclaving. Distortion occurs between 240° to 270° F. It is not recommended for cold or sub-freezing temperatures.
